Transaction bbebc8e7f66ccd3021f7518875c16299c393203c3e4bf63fbbaab571873b3983
1 Input
1 Output
-
bbebc8e7f66ccd3021f7518875c16299c393203c3e4bf63fbbaab571873b3983:0
- value
- 2857064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c029facbf96c12d29d94012a5c2cc858ed502c41 OP_EQUAL
- address
- 3KD5xB44jiKXYV9PiDqe7Z6UHYhBSgrZF5